On Friday 27 January 2006 04:18, Frank Staals wrote:
> Hmm I got a question regarding to Fx 1.5. Has anyone else noticed a
> tremendous slowdown when using 1.5 ? I especially mean when the
> popup-window opens to ask what you want to do with a download (
> save it or open it ) then Fx hangs for about 15 seconds ( while the
> 'ok' button is not clickable ) then It continues again. Also
> Firefox crashed when I tried using an upload function ( to attach a
> file to a post in a forum ).
>
> Anyone else had problems with this ? ( Using Xfce4.2.3.1 with
> gtk2.8.9 here )
This has also been reported by other people including myself.  There 
doesn't seem to be any progress on diagnosing the problem.  The only 
thing I've been able to notice is that if I run truss on the firefox 
process during it's slowdown/hang it shows that firefox is repeatedly 
calling the kse_release system call.
